The Configuration of High Mast Light:
1. Expertly crafted, these high mast lights typically boast a dodecagon or octagonal conical pole design. Utilizing high-strength steel plates, precision-cut, and skillfully bent,and automated welding processes, these structures stand proudly at heights of 25m, 30m, and 35m, with an impressive wind resistance capability of up to 60 meters per second.
2. Incorporating a functional framework that marries utility with aesthetics, these poles use primarily steel materials for decorative purposes. Essential components such as the steel pipe, lamp post, and lamp plate undergo hot dip galvanizing for enhanced durability.
3. The advanced electric lifting system is a marvel of modern engineering, featuring an electric motor, winch, and three sets of hot dip galvanized steel wire ropes, complete with specialized cables.Inside the lamp post, the system boasts an impressive lifting speed of 3 to 5 meters per minute, ensuring swift and efficient operation.
4. The guiding and unloading system, meticulously designed with guide wheels and a guide arm, ensures that the lamp plate remains stable and does not move transversely.throughout the lifting process. Once the lamp plate reaches its designated position, it automatically descends and locks securely using a hook mechanism.
5. A robust lighting electrical system powers between 6 to 24 lamps, available in 400 W or 1000 W, utilizing metal halide (white light) lamps for both spot and floodlighting.Equipped with a computer time controller, this system offers the flexibility to automatically adjust the illumination settings, allowing for partial or full lighting based on requirements.
6. For comprehensive safety and protection, the system includes a lightning protection feature, complete with a 1.5 meters long lightning rod.
The underground foundation is meticulously designed with one-meter-long grounding wires, securely welded to the underground bolt for optimal protection.

Classification of High Pole Lamps
High pole lamps are generally categorized into lifting and non-lifting types. The lifting type, featuring a main pole height exceeding 18m, facilitates convenient electric operation. When elevated to its working position, the lamp tray can seamlessly detach, secure within the ditch, and offload the wire rope.
The lifting type high-pole lamp offers dual control options—manual and electric—ensuring the lamp tray can be safely and reliably lowered to a manageable height of 2.5 meters above the ground for maintenance ease.
A manual remote control device, equipped with a 10m lead-out wire, empowers operators to control the lamp panel's lift from a safe 5m distance, ensuring utmost personal safety.
Each lift-type high-pole lamp includes a spare cable for operational backup. When the lamp tray descends to the appropriate position, one cable end connects to the electrical control system's socket, while the other inserts into the lamp tray's junction box, facilitating direct power supply for maintenance.
Boasting an IP65 international standard sealing grade, the lift-type high-pole lamp's lamps and lanterns are safeguarded against dust and rain, prolonging bulb service life. Constructed from premium aluminum alloy plates and stainless steel, these materials offer superior corrosion resistance.
